What Are the Rights of the Personal Data Owner under Article 11 of Law No. 6698?

As per Article 11 of the Law, data subjects have the right to:

  • Learn whether personal data are processed
  • Request information regarding processed data
  • Learn the purpose of processing and whether data are used appropriately
  • Know third parties to whom data are transferred domestically or abroad
  • Request correction of incomplete or inaccurate data and notification to third parties
  • Request deletion or destruction of data when reasons for processing cease and notification to third parties
  • Object to outcomes against them arising from automated analysis
  • Claim compensation for damages caused by unlawful processing
